Edna Cano
Edna Cano, a native of Benque, Belize, was 20 years old when she was awarded the Summit Fellowship. Teaching at a Catholic high school in Santa Elena, Cayo, Edna instructs Social Studies, Geography, Life Skills and Spanish to young students. Rather than let the conservative values of the school limit her capacity to teach her students about sexual and reproductive health (SRH), she has managed through creativity and strategic thinking to cover these topics. She has an Associates Degree in International Business and for her future hopes to be an even better teacher and possibly a principle of a school where she can set an example of good leadership, providing positive direction and meeting the needs of the students.
